Cangjie5 开源项目教程
Cangjie5倉頡五代補完計劃项目地址:https://gitcode.com/gh_mirrors/ca/Cangjie5
1. 项目的目录结构及介绍
Cangjie5 项目的目录结构如下:
Cangjie5/
├── README.md
├── src/
│ ├── main.cpp
│ ├── config.json
│ └── utils/
│ ├── helper.cpp
│ └── helper.h
└── tests/
└── test_main.cpp
- README.md: 项目介绍文件,包含项目的基本信息和使用说明。
- src/: 源代码目录,包含项目的主要代码文件。
- main.cpp: 项目的启动文件。
- config.json: 项目的配置文件。
- utils/: 工具函数目录,包含辅助功能的实现。
- helper.cpp: 辅助功能实现文件。
- helper.h: 辅助功能头文件。
- tests/: 测试代码目录,包含项目的测试文件。
- test_main.cpp: 测试启动文件。
2. 项目的启动文件介绍
项目的启动文件是 src/main.cpp
。该文件负责初始化项目并启动主程序。以下是 main.cpp
的基本结构:
#include <iostream>
#include "utils/helper.h"
int main() {
// 初始化配置
loadConfig("config.json");
// 启动主程序
startProgram();
return 0;
}
- loadConfig("config.json"): 加载配置文件
config.json
。 - startProgram(): 启动主程序的函数。
3. 项目的配置文件介绍
项目的配置文件是 src/config.json
。该文件包含项目运行所需的各种配置参数。以下是 config.json
的基本结构:
{
"server": {
"host": "127.0.0.1",
"port": 8080
},
"database": {
"username": "admin",
"password": "password123",
"name": "cangjie_db"
}
}
- server: 服务器配置,包含主机地址和端口号。
- database: 数据库配置,包含用户名、密码和数据库名称。
以上是 Cangjie5 开源项目的目录结构、启动文件和配置文件的介绍。希望这些信息能帮助你更好地理解和使用该项目。
Cangjie5倉頡五代補完計劃项目地址:https://gitcode.com/gh_mirrors/ca/Cangjie5